In this week's podcast episode, Sherry delves into the topic of high-functioning depression and sheds light on why entrepreneurs may be particularly susceptible to it. She explores the symptoms associated with this condition and highlights the potential challenges healthcare professionals face in identifying it among entrepreneurs, as the diagnosis of depression traditionally revolves around functional impairment.
